Factors to Consider When Choosing Fletch Baby Clothes
When selecting Fletch baby clothes, prioritize fabric quality to guarantee softness and gentleness on your baby's delicate skin. The right fabric can make all the difference, ensuring comfort and preventing any irritations.
Look for breathable fabrics like organic cotton that allow your baby's skin to breathe and regulate temperature, keeping them cozy all day long.
Practical designs are a must-have when choosing Fletch baby clothes. Opt for pieces with adjustable features such as snaps or elastic to accommodate your baby's growth spurts effortlessly. These thoughtful details not only assure the right fit but also make dressing and changing routines a breeze.
Understanding Fletch Baby Clothing Sizes
To guarantee proper sizing for your little one when choosing Fletch baby clothing, refer to the specific size guide provided by Fletch or the retailer. Fletch baby clothing sizes typically range from newborn to 24 months, following standard size charts for age and weight recommendations. Understanding that Fletch baby clothes may run true to size or have variations, checking reviews or seeking recommendations can assist in choosing the right size. Keep in mind that babies grow quickly, so considering a size up for longer wear can be beneficial when selecting Fletch baby clothing. Understanding the fit and measurements of Fletch baby clothes is key to making informed decisions to ensure comfort and mobility for your child.
Age | Size Guide |
---|---|
Newborn | Up to 7 lbs |
0-3M | 7-12 lbs |
3-6M | 12-16 lbs |
6-9M | 16-20 lbs |
9-12M | 20-24 lbs |
Safety Tips for Fletch Baby Clothes
Consider selecting baby clothes labeled as flame-resistant to mitigate fire hazards and guarantee your child's safety.
When choosing fletch baby clothes, prioritize well-secured buttons and snaps to prevent any choking hazards during diaper changes.
Opt for garments made from non-toxic materials to make sure your baby's delicate skin remains unharmed.
It's important to avoid clothing with loose strings or embellishments that could potentially pose a strangulation risk.
Look for safety certifications like Oeko-Tex Standard 100 to further make sure the quality and safety of the clothing you select for your little one.
